I recently posted a "want to buy" ad for a lens. I have received two private messages with the following text:
"Email jackson in Texas He has a Leica 90-280 SL lens*for sale. Here's his email [email protected]" from a new user SMIKKY with zero posts,
and
"Contact Richard He has a Leica 90-280 SL lens for sale. Here's his email [email protected]" from a new user ADAM1 also with zero posts.
When I contacted one of the email addresses, the person said they have no feedback on any sites, they have a "private store" in Missouri, and they didn't reply to my request for pictures of the lens with a spoon in the photo, a technique often used to validate sellers.
Be aware of these fairly unsophisticated scam attempts. Never buy or sell to users with no history and no feedback.
